The Three Most Common Hearing Aid Problems
Malfunctioning hearing aids brought into South Shore Hearing Centers usually fall into one of three categories of problems:
1. Earwax Accumulation: There’s some regular cleaning that can be done at home, but internal components should be looked after by an expert technician. Earwax buildup accounts for 20%-30% of all hearing aid malfunctions, and most users will experience it at some point. Some manufacturers include extra filters and wax cleaning tools, but it can be tough to access the internal tubing.
2. Corrosion from Moisture: Introduce new sounds to your hearing aids, but never let them meet water. Moisture is bad news for almost every area of hearing aids, from the battery to the circuitry. Devices exposed to moisture might perform poorly or shut off entirely.
3. Physical Damage or Defects: Even if we’re careful, hearing aids endure some wear and tear from daily life. Through regular use, and occasional mishandling, wires and other internal components might need repair. These issues can limit performance and possibly make hearing aids ineffective.
Most of these issues are preventable if you develop a habit of cleaning and inspecting your hearing aids daily and by following the recommended maintenance schedule of your hearing aid and/or hearing care provider. Daily cleaning and inspection not only helps control earwax and moisture problems, but it also makes it easier to spot physical damage and defects early so you can bring them in for repair before they become a more costly issue.
